Bolts for Installation and Shock Length for Roadmaster Replacement Shock Absorber  

Updated 07/31/2020 | Published 07/29/2020

Question:

Hello, Looking to replace the shocks on a single axle 3,500. my question is about the eyelets on the ends of the shocks. What size bolt/shaft are they for? The mounts for my shocks are 5/8inch on the bottom and almost 3/4inch at the top. I am looking at your Replacement Shock Absorber for Roadmaster Comfort Ride Trailer Suspension System - Qty 1 Item # RM-204000-00. Previously I was able to get a shock with rubber bushings in the eyelets that was probably designed for a 5/8inch bolt or shaft and was able to force it on the larger end with some grease. Other specifications include 12inch collapsed and about 19inch extended and might have some wiggle room.

Expert Reply:

The Replacement Shock Absorber # RM-204000-00 is installed using M12 x 1.75 x 100mm — class 8.8 bolts and it measures 11-1/2" when compressed and 17-1/2" when extended.

This shock is designed specifically for the Roadmaster Comfort Ride system like the kit # RM-2450 which is for a tandem 3,500 lb axle trailer.

Since you have a single axle trailer I recommend going with the Lippert Components Bolt-On Shock Kit w/ Heavy Duty Gas Shocks # LC281255 instead.
